MacCentre
Форум: Mac и Mac OS X
Тема: Переустановка MySQL

[Ответить]
krayev [20.03.2009 01:31] Переустановка MySQL:
После установки на iMac (Mac OS X 10.5.6) MySQL 5.1.32, по всей видимости по неопытности, что-то не то сделал.
То-есть сначала все вроде-бы заработало сервер стартовал и останавливался. А потом вдруг перестал стартовать. Нажимаешь кнопку Старт MySQL Server, а она значение не меняет и сервер не стартует. В терминале на команду mysqld_safe - пишет ошибка 2002.
Помогите разобраться.
Попытки переименовать директорию MySQL не увенчались успехом пишет read only system files или Permission denied
После ввода команды:
sudo /usr/local/mysql/bin/mysqld_safe
выдает следуещее:
090320 02:50:35 mysqld_safe Logging to '/usr/local/mysql/data/localhost.err'.
090320 02:50:35 mysqld_safe Starting mysqld daemon with databases from /usr/local/mysql/data
090320 02:50:36 mysqld_safe mysqld from pid file /usr/local/mysql/data/localhost.pid ended
krayev [20.03.2009 09:09] Re: Переустановка MySQL:
Сношу всю директорию mysql, ставлю заново, проблема сохраняется.
Genbor [20.03.2009 09:32] :
значит не всю - это раз :)
нет желания попробовать MAMP или еще что-нить подобное?
krayev [20.03.2009 10:25] :
MAMP 1.7.2 установил, Appache запустился а SQL Server не стартует.
А как правильно все удалить, подскажите.
krayev [20.03.2009 10:27] :
В Log-ах пушут:
090320 09:27:15 mysqld started
090320 9:27:15 [ERROR] /Applications/MAMP/Library/libexec/mysqld: unknown option '--enable-named-pipe'

090320 09:27:15 mysqld ended
craz [23.03.2009 15:52] Нодо логи читать, однако:
в /etc или в ~/ размести my.cnf. В нем пропиши, чтобы логи он складывал куда-нибудь в общее место, к примеру /var/log/mysqld и читай через console.app, а то ведь к '/usr/local/mysql/data/localhost.err' не доберешься.
В логах обычно он все понятненько рассказывает
craz [23.03.2009 16:03] :
[ERROR] /Applications/MAMP/Library/libexec/mysqld: unknown option '--enable-named-pipe'

А похоже там теперь 2 MySQLa стоит. Один в /usr/local а другой в мампе ;)
Кого-то прибить надо
craz [24.03.2009 04:58] --enable-named-pipe:
Вообще-то этот параметр используется только для виндовой версии MySql.
krayev [24.03.2009 22:11] :
Все что можно было удалил.
Пытаюсь установить MySQL 5.0.77, а он мне говорит, что на диске установлена более поздняя версия.

Отцы, помогите, как все удалить?
Art-Roman [25.03.2009 08:44] :
А обязательно удалять? Может достаточно автозагрузку почистить, где-то ведт старт мускула прописан… А если уже мешать не будет, то и мучаться с удалением нет повода ))
Мне хватает того, что есть в мампе. Хотя на тигре ставил сам, потом и папм добавил - мускул кидал свой автостартер в логин айтеймс, откуда я его и убрал: ничто никому не мешало.
[Ответить]